Simona Quadarella won the gold medal in the 400m freestyle at the European Swimming Championships. The Italian, gold medalist in the 800 and 1500, completed a hat-trick with an extraordinary finish and a superb performance finishing in 4’01″34 ahead of the Germans Isabel Gose (4’02″41) and Maya Werner (4’03″73), securing a clear victory against top-level opponents. In the penultimate lap, she caught up with and overtook Werner, and then in the last lap she clearly distanced Gose, who had led until that moment. Italy returns to the top of the medal table for the moment: tied with Great Britain in the number of golds (13), but with 9 more silvers (13 to 4). For the Roman athlete, this is the eleventh gold medal at the European Championships. In Paris, during this dream week, the Italian had already won for the fourth time in her career the gold medal in the 800 meters freestyle and in the 1500 meters freestyle (in 15’46″22, a new championship record).
“I tried to wait as long as possible, even though at one point I didn’t think I would win because it seemed my opponents wouldn’t give up anything,” confesses Simona at the poolside. “I didn’t even expect to deliver this performance, but I did it. The thing that impresses me the most is the consistency and always managing to stay there, maybe even with some difficulties like in the 1500, where I wasn’t so happy with my time despite the gold. Before, in the 400, I couldn’t perform very well, now I have found the right key.”
Silver shines instead on Sunday for Thomas Ceccon in Paris. The Italian, beaten by one hundredth, finished second in the 100 meters backstroke. The gold went to the Greek Apostolos Christou, the bronze to the Russian Pavel Samusenko. Another silver for Italy in the men’s 4×100 medley relay: Thomas Ceccon, Nicolo Martinenghi, Alberto Razzetti, and Carlos D’Ambrosio finished second in 3’28″86, behind only Russia, with France taking bronze.
